Toyota Innova Hycross: Innova Highcross, a new Toyota MPV, was just introduced to the Indian market. This MPV offers a hybrid powertrain option and an SUV-like appearance. The Innova Highcross was introduced in December for a starting price of Rs 18.30 lakh (ex-showroom). It has been released in a total of 10 variations, including 6 powerful hybrid self-charging variants and 4 petrol engines. Customers are responding positively to this car as well. The corporation has decided to raise the cost of this car in the meantime. This three-row MPV's price has raised by up to Rs 75,000 according to Toyota.
The starting price of the Toyota Innova HyCross has increased to Rs. 18.55 lakhs. The petrol variant received a rise of Rs. 25,000, and the petrol + hybrid model received an increase of Rs. 75,000. Starting at Rs 18.55 lakh (ex-showroom), the Innova HyCross petrol variant will now cost, with the top-spec GX 8-seater variant costing Rs 19.45 lakh (ex-showroom). Similar to how the Strong Hybrid variant's costs have changed, they now begin at Rs 24.76 lakh (ex-showroom) and can reach Rs 29.75 lakh (ex-showroom).

Features
Toyota's latest generation of MPV has ventilated front seats, a 10-inch touchscreen infotainment system, a digital driver's display, dual-zone climate control, and these features. In addition, it boasts a wireless phone charger, a 360-degree camera, connected car technology, and a panoramic sunroof.
